ABSOLUTE MAXIMUM RATINGS
Supply voltage, V+
+10.6V
Differential input voltage range
-0.3V to V+ +0.3V
Power dissipation
600 mW
Operating temperature range PC, SC package
0
°C to +70°C
DC package
-55
°C to +125°C
Storage temperature range
-65
°C to +150°C
Lead temperature, 10 seconds
+260
°C
